Why Therapy?

Relationship therapy offers the opportunity to explore your relationship in a confidential and therapeutic environment. It provides a neutral space where you can work through the challenges you’re facing together. My approach encourages a deep exploration of your relationship, focusing on each person’s perspective and how you interact with one another.

Relationship therapy isn’t just for couples in crisis—it's a chance to identify patterns that no longer serve you, address communication issues, and find healthier ways to navigate life’s challenges.

Common issues that couples face include:

  • Fears that the spark has gone

  • Chronic conflict or constant arguments

  • Infidelity

  • Differing sex drives or intimacy concerns

  • Struggles with conception

  • Parenting disagreements

  • Adjusting to major life changes, such as illness or aging

  • Deciding whether to stay together or separate

How I Work

In my practice, I offer a committed, curious and compassionate space where you and your partner can explore your concerns openly. As an integrative practitioner, I draw from a range of therapeutic approaches to tailor my work to your unique needs. This flexibility allows me to respond to you both in a way that is aligned with where you are in your relationship and individual journeys.

I encourage open dialogue about your past and present experiences, helping to identify recurring patterns, beliefs, and their potential impact on your current relationship.

Throughout our work together, therapy will be a collaborative and creative process. I will offer insight, gently challenge you, or suggest alternative perspectives to help facilitate change, but I will always respect your autonomy. If appropriate, I may also introduce mindful or communicative exercises to explore together within your relationship.

No matter the issue, therapy provides a space to process emotions, gain insight, and rebuild communication, helping you regain clarity and move forward with greater understanding.
